All about the name YAQOOT

Meaning, origin, history.

Yaqoot is a unique and beautiful name of Arabic origin. It is derived from the Arabic word "yaqut," which means "ruby." In Arabic culture, rubies are considered to be one of the four precious stones along with diamonds, pearls, and emeralds.

The name Yaqoot is often associated with rarity, beauty, and value, much like the ruby itself. It is believed that the ruby has the power to protect its wearer from evil and bring them good fortune.
